Sometimes we can overdo the exercise which increases our stress hormone, cortisol, along with reduced sleep and other stressors we can set up for this issue. Increased insulin levels from raised cortisol make you feel low energy, and cause a host of other problems. When you're tired pay careful attention to your diet and try not to get too many simple carbohydrates. They're just going to cause a more severe crash later. Have a great weekend and get some rest!
